  • Logic Crashes when there are more than 24 instances of VE Pro loaded

    I came across an VE Pro/Logic issue while trying to expand my Logic template. I discovered that when I try to connect a VEP AU plug-in instrument, and there are more than 24 VEPro server instances available, Logic crashes. I saw that someone else had the same issue on this forum, but no solution has been presented. I could use fewer instances in my template if I were to use the IAC MIDI bus, but it seems like the VSL team is discouraging the use of the IAC MIDI bus. My understanding is that we are supposed to be able to use up to 128 VE Pro instances. Anyone else having the same issue? Can the VSL team make any suggestions?

  • MacPro3,1, 8 x 2.8 GHz CPU, 18 GB Ram, Mac OS 10.6.3, Logic 9.1.1 (problem occurs in both 32bit and 64bit modes), VE Pro v4.0.5814. I am using VSL instruments (v2.1.5740) and other libraries using Kontakt (v4.1.0.3681). However the crash occurs even with instances loaded that are empty (no sounds loaded).

  • I can confirm that I consistently experience this issue.

    To fully qualify the bug report, it is "more than 24 UNCONNECTED instances available to the VEP AU plugin inside Logic Pro 9.1.1 under OSX10.4.6 = certain crash of Logic".

    I think that so long as you keep connecting the instances to remove them from the "available instances" list, you can get above 24 instances. Just not very helpful for those of us who like to run Decoupled.
